In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
usb-storage: alauda: Check whether the media is initialized
The member “uzonesize” of struct alauda_info will remain 0 if alauda_init_media() fails, potentially causing divide errors in alauda_read_data() and alauda_write_lba().
- Add a member “media_initialized” to struct alauda_info.
- Change a condition in alauda_check_media() to ensure the first initialization.
- Add an error check for the return value of alauda_init_media().
